Lot description:


Alexander III, 336 – 323 and posthumous issues.
Stater, uncertain mint in Greece or Macedonia circa 310-275, AV 18 mm, 8.59 g. Head of Athena r., wearing Corinthian helmet decorated with snake. Rev. ΑΛΕΞΑΝΔΡΟΥ Nike standing to l., holding stylis in l. hand and wreath in r.; in l. field, ant and below, star. Price 831.
A minor nick at eleven o'clock on reverse, otherwise extremely fine
